Subject: Rotation notice for EXIF scrubber credentials

For this week's sync: we rotated the service key used by the Brindlefox EXIF scrubbing pipeline after the quarterly audit flagged it as past its rotation window. No incident occurred. The scrubber strips GPS and device metadata from all uploaded images before CDN distribution; behavior is unchanged. Deploys referencing the old key will fail health checks starting Monday, so update your local configs and the staging overrides. The replacement key for the scrubber service is below.

gateway credential: kto3_qfe

Escalation — TilePorter Prefetcher

If prefetch queue depth stays above 5,000 for more than ten minutes, plugin authors should first disable any custom region hints and retry. If tile fetch latency remains degraded after a queue drain, escalate to the prefetch platform team rather than restarting workers yourself, as restarts reset warm caches. Include your plugin version and region set in the escalation message.

alerts address for fahip-kajep: istox.fraox@qorvellabs.internal

**CI note — Gridsmith crossword generator**

If the Gridsmith build goes red on the `fill-engine` tests, it's almost always the dictionary snapshot being stale — the Wordhoard fetch step silently grabs a cached copy. Bump the snapshot version in the pipeline config and rerun; don't bother rerunning without the bump, it'll fail the same way. The last run confirmed green after a fresh snapshot is logged below.

trace token, fafog-kageg: htk4_98e6